June 30, 1960 marks the independence of the Democratic Republic of the Congo, bringing an end to Belgian colonial rule.
Alongside His Excellency Léopold Bompese Lofemba,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Democratic Republic of the Congo to the Kingdom of Sweden, the DCN, and organizations from Norway, Finland and Denmark, discussions focused on the future prospects of a Congo facing numerous challenges.
For Congo Bridge Council, invited to take part in this commemoration, the discussions centered on the future prospects that the Congo should consider, while honoring and remembering the martyrs who died for freedom.

Today in Oslo 🇳🇴, we participated in the launch of Caritas Norway’s new report on strengthening locally led humanitarian action.
It was a great initiative and an important opportunity for learning and exchange around the challenges, partnerships, and perspectives of local NGOs.
We mainly discussed the realities of humanitarian work in Africa, Asia, Latin America, and the Middle East, as well as the development of young local organizations.
Congo Bridge Council was also part of this exchange to learn, build connections, and further develop its vision for education and health between international institutions and local partners.

The Congo Bridge Council team visited a maternity center in Kinshasa to listen to the challenges women face after childbirth.
The team took time to engage, raise awareness about our mission, and provide small packages of essential supplies to mothers and pregnant women.
